Understanding the CAF Qualification Process
Alright, first things first, let's get the lowdown on how the CAF teams earn their spot in the 2026 World Cup. This time around, the stakes are higher than ever, and the opportunities are even bigger. The 2026 World Cup will feature a whopping 48 teams, meaning CAF has a fantastic chance to shine, with 9 direct spots up for grabs! That's right, nine African nations will be heading straight to the World Cup, alongside the hosts. But wait, there's more! There's also a potential tenth spot. This tenth team will get the chance to participate in a play-off tournament! This means it's not just about finishing in the top nine. Any team that finishes in the top nine spots will get the chance to play in the World Cup! This provides many opportunities for several African teams to showcase their skills on the world stage, with a good chance to qualify!
The format itself is quite straightforward but with some unique twists. CAF has divided its member associations into groups, where the teams will compete in a round-robin format, playing each other home and away. The team that wins each group gets a ticket to the World Cup. It's a straight shot, a test of consistency, and a battle of wills. Teams to Watch: Potential Contenders
Now, let's get to the good stuff: the teams. Africa is a treasure trove of footballing talent, and this year's qualifiers promise to be a showdown of epic proportions. The usual suspects will be there, ready to battle for their spot in the World Cup. We're talking about the powerhouses of African football. Teams like Senegal, the reigning African champions, Morocco, who had an unforgettable run at the last World Cup, and Nigeria, with their rich footballing history and a roster packed with talent. These teams are always ones to watch, and they bring a blend of experience and ambition to the table. They have proven themselves on the international stage and are hungry for more glory.
But don't count out the underdogs! African football is full of surprises, and there's always a team that emerges from nowhere to shock the world. Teams like Algeria, Egypt, and Cameroon will be looking to reassert their dominance and prove that they're still forces to be reckoned with. They've got the talent and the determination to go all the way. It will be exciting to see how they perform in this competitive environment. And let's not forget the rising stars! Teams like Ivory Coast, Ghana, and Tunisia are constantly improving and have the potential to cause some serious upsets. They have the hunger and the drive to make a name for themselves.
